The process of forcing salt water through a permeable membrane in order to remove the salt from the water is known as Reverse osmosis.

Reverse osmosis is a desalination method that uses selectively permeable membranes and high pressure to remove salt from saltwater.

In addition, reverse osmosis (RO) is a method of water filtration that eliminates ions, molecules, and bigger particles from drinking water by using a semipermeable membrane.
